    Default Ok to remove/empty unused sql authorizenet?

    I'm making space on my server and don't want to cause problems. I found a file /mysql/DATABASE/authorizenet.MYD that is very large. It is 43mb and the 9th largest file/directory on my server.

    I haven't used authorize.net in 2 years. Is it safe to empty this table?

    Default Re: Ok to remove/empty unused sql authorizenet?

    YOUR POST IS SERIOUSLY ALARMING!!!!

    If you have no history in it which you need to keep, then you can truncate the table.

    BUT DO NOT EVER delete .MYD files by hand!!!!!!!! Seriously. YOU SHOULD NOT BE MUCKING AROUND IN THAT FOLDER AT ALL!!!!!!!!!
    If you're going to delete data associated with a given table, then make a solid reliable backup and truncate the table using phpMyAdmin. DO NOT DELETE MYSQL DATABASE FILES DIRECTLY!!!!!!! EVER!!!!!!
